The Deets
Okay, so boom. Newfoundland and Labrador are dealing with some major fire vibes. We're talking wildfires that are forcing mad evacuations - like, 14,000 residents gotta yeet outta their towns. They even had to declare a regional state of emergency for the Bay de Verde Peninsula, sending everyone to Carbonear. It's that real.
Peep this: high winds and dry conditions are making these fires rage harder than a Friday night party. Firefighters were like, "Nah, it's too risky," and had to pull back for a sec. But don't sweat it, they're back with four air tankers, five helicopters, and over 50 firefighters. Quebec and New Brunswick are even sending backup. Teamwork makes the dream work, ya know?
The Kingston fire is the biggest baddie, stretching over 50 kmΒ². The Martin Lake fire is mostly chillin' tho. But here's the messed up part: nine homes are GONE. And some ppl think it was arson, which is totally sus. They're offering a $5,000 reward to snitch on the culprits. Don't be a silent bystander, fam!
The gov's stepping up with a $500 drop for affected households and tryna get insurance companies to be less stingy with disaster coverage. Plus, there's a province-wide fire ban with fines starting at $50,000. Like, seriously, don't be playing with fire, it's not a joke.
On the bright side, evacuation orders for Holyrood and Conception Bay South were lifted 'cause they contained a fire. W for the good guys!
